Guitarist Duties & Responsibilities

The role and function of a Guitarist includes the following duties and responsibilities:

  • Setting up and performing for live audiences, and attending rehearsals and studio sessions in a timely manner.
  • Maintaining all gear and tuning guitars when necessary.
  • Practicing on your own prior to studio sessions and rehearsals.
  • Learning melodies, songs, and practicing vocals when required.
  • Locating and traveling out to venues for gigs.
  • Networking with other musicians and industry professionals.
  • Preparing for and attending auditions.
  • Experimenting with different genres, types of guitars, and improving improv techniques.
  • Attending all PR events and maintaining an appropriate online presence and public image.
  • Responding well to feedback and recommendations, as well as offering helpful suggestions.

Note that this is not an exhaustive list of Guitarist duties and responsibilities. Job functions for specific Guitarist roles may vary, depending on the industry and type of employer.
